I am setting up new users with email with something like
"kd@xxxxxxxxxx", and an alias like "kathy", with a forward to
"kd@xxxxxxxxxxxxx"; and when I try to send a message to
"kathy@xxxxxxxxxx" it bounces back undeliverable tells me user not
known.
I am setting up email via the DNS as recommended throughout the archives
as:
A rec = domain --> IP
A rec = www.domain --> IP
PTR = IP --> domain
PTR = IP --> www.domain
A rec = mail.domain.com
MX = domain.com --> mail.domain.com
when setting up virtual site, put in email alias of "mail.domain.com"
I first tried this using the method in the manual (ahem), which said to
actually do
the
MC = domain.com --> www.domain.com
without the A rec
didn't work.
Question is this: does an alias such as "kathy" for username "kd" NOT
forward to an external domain, or is there some switch or something I'm
missing.
It would seem logical that "kathy" would just be an alias of "kd" and
dump stuff the same place. But, no.
